Overview

The Sci-Supply Hand Crank DC Generator is a compact, portable tool designed for hands-on science learning. By turning the crank, students generate real DC power and visually observe how mechanical energy can become electrical energy in a safe, classroom-friendly setup. The device offers tactile feedback from the gears and a responsive output that makes energy concepts feel tangible rather than theoretical.

Ideal for physics and STEM classrooms, homeschool setups, and student-led labs, this generator supports activities across energy transfer, electromagnetism, and basic circuit principles. Its approachable size and straightforward operation help educators introduce core ideas without complexity or risk.

How it Works and What You Can Explore

Use the hand crank to drive the generator, acquiring a practical sense of energy flow. Observations can be paired with simple circuits to illuminate how current is produced and how voltage behaves under different conditions. This setup supports inquiry-based learning, enabling students to connect physical effort with electrical outcomes in real time.

  • Turn the crank to generate DC power and light small bulbs or LEDs in simple circuits.
  • See a tangible demonstration of energy transfer and circuit concepts in real time.
  • Adjust rotation speed to explore relationships between effort and electrical output.

Durability and Educational Design

Manufactured for frequent classroom use, the unit features a sturdy housing and easily replaceable gears. It’s built to withstand repeated cranking during labs, demonstrations, and group activities, helping instructors keep lessons moving smoothly over time. The 6V DC output provides a reliable target for small experiments while remaining safe and approachable for beginners.

What’s Included and Practical Classroom Scenarios

Beyond the core generator, the kit includes two replacement gear sets, ensuring continued demonstrations even with heavy classroom use. This arrangement supports ongoing experimentation across multiple classes without lengthy downtime.

  • Includes two replacement gear sets for quick maintenance during ongoing sessions.
  • Durable housing designed for hands-on demonstrations and student-led activities.
